1. Use Boiling Water


When confronted with a blocked sink, the first thing you must try is to pour boiling water down the drainpipe. That is about the most straightforward solution to clogged up sinks and drainages. Boiling water assists reduce the effects of the bits and also particles causing the clog, particularly if it's oil, grease, or soap bits, and in many cases, it can flush it all down, as well as your sink will be back to normal.
Do not attempt this technique if you have plastic pipelines (PVC) because warm water might thaw the lines and also create even more damages. If you utilize plastic pipes, you might intend to stay with using a bettor to obtain debris out.
Utilizing this method, activate the tap to see how water streams after putting hot water down the tubes. If the blockage continues, attempt the procedure once more. However, the clog could be more relentless sometimes and call for greater than just boiling water.

4. Baking Soda as well as Vinegar


Rather than utilizing any type of chemicals or bleach, this approach is much safer as well as not unsafe to you or your sink. Baking soda and also vinegar are day-to-day home products used for many other things, and they can do the technique to your cooking area sink.
Firstly, get rid of any type of water that is left in the sink with a mug.
Then put an excellent amount of cooking soft drink away.
Pour in one cup of vinegar.
Seal the water drainage opening and enable it to opt for some minutes.
Pour hot water down the drain to melt away other stubborn residue as well as fragments.
Following this basic approach could do the trick, and you can have your cooking area sink back. Repeat the procedure as high as you regard essential to clear the sink of this particles totally.

How to Unclog a Kitchen Sink


Take the Plunge



Start your efforts by plunging. Use a plunger with a large rubber bell and a sturdy handle. Before getting to work on the drain, clamp the drain line to the dishwasher. If you don t close the line, plunging could force dirty water into the dishwasher.



Fill the sink with several inches of water. This ensures a good seal over the drain.



If you have a double sink, plug the other drain with a wet rag or strainer.



Insert the plunger at an angle, making sure water, not air, fills the bell.



Plunge forcefully several times. Pop off the plunger.



Repeat plunging and popping several times until the water drains.




Clean the Trap



The P-trap is the curved pipe under the sink. The trap arm is the straight pipe that attaches to the P-trap and runs to the drain stub-out on the wall. Grease and debris can block this section of pipe. Here s how to unclog a kitchen sink by cleaning out the trap:



Remove as much standing water from the sink as possible.



Place a bucket under the pipe to catch the water as it drains.



Unscrew the slip nuts at both ends of the P-trap. Use slip-joint pliers and work carefully to avoid damaging the pipes or fasteners.



If you find a clog, remove it. Reassemble the trap.



If the P-trap isn t clogged, remove the trap arm and look for clogs there. Run the tip of a screwdriver into the drain stub-out to fetch nearby gunk.




Spin the Auger




With the trap disassembled, you re ready to crank the auger down the drain line.



Pull a 12-inch length of cable from the auger and tighten the setscrew.



Insert the auger into the drain line, easing it into the pipe.



Feed the cable into the line until you feel an obstruction. Pull out more cable if you need to.



If you come to a clog, crank and push the cable until you feel it break through. The cable will lose tension when this happens.



Crank counterclockwise to pull out the cable, catching the grime and debris with a rag as the cable retracts.
